The GateCount endpoint of the Varmont Stadium platform returns cumulative turnstile tallies per entrance, sampled every thirty seconds. Reviewers should note that counts are monotonic within a session but reset at the daily rollover, so clients must reconcile using the session_id field rather than raw deltas. All requests to /v2/gates/counts require authorization, and malformed headers return a 401 with no body. Authenticate using the bearer token below.

session JWT of yawep-yawep = eyJhbGciOiJIUzI1NiIsInR5cCI6IkpXVCJ9.eyJzdWIiOiI3pWF3_In0.aXYsHiog

## Runbook: Bouncewell email bounce processor

If the bounce queue backs up past 10k messages, restart the processor on the mailer host and verify it reconnects to the Postgate relay. Check logs for repeated 401 errors; that usually means the env file was regenerated without the relay credential. Confirm the file permissions are 600 before editing. The relay authentication secret belongs on the line directly after this one.

sealed setting: ARCHIVE_KEY3=8d0

Status: Open

The Paybridge vault holding idempotency keys for payment retries locked itself after three failed unseal attempts during last night's maintenance window. External plugin authors: retried charges will currently return a 503 rather than deduplicating, so do not disable your client-side idempotency headers — they remain the only safeguard until the vault is unsealed. Keys generated before the lock are preserved and will be honored once service resumes. To unseal the vault, operators should enter the recovery passphrase below.

vault phrase of kafog-kahif = holdor-rusir-praox